What Does the Job Involve?

This job offers a salary estimated between £18,000 and £30,000 per year, with full-time hours and no home-based option. Training is included, so prior experience is not required.

As a Field Sales Executive, your main day-to-day duties revolve around representing a leading telecoms brand, promoting top-tier TV, internet, and wireless services directly to potential customers.

You’ll be interacting with people, building rapport, and closing sales—all with support from a driving company culture and clear career pathways. Your performance directly affects your commission, so ambition is essential.

A full (manual) driving licence is required. You’ll have opportunities to utilise a company car and can earn uncapped commission for your success in the field.

It’s a position for someone motivated, ready to work independently, and willing to learn new sales techniques through structured, ongoing coaching and training sessions.

Day-to-Day Responsibilities

Your day starts with preparing for field visits. After meeting with your team for a quick debrief, you’ll visit various locations, representing the Sky brand in a positive, professional manner.

The primary responsibility is to promote and sell Sky’s telecom products. This involves engaging with the public, explaining services, answering questions, and ultimately driving sales through persuasive communication.

Tracking performance is also important. You’ll regularly report your sales activity and collaborate with your manager to review targets and deliverables. Team events and coaching are part of the routine.

Throughout your week, you’ll benefit from a company car, fair expense reimbursement, and plenty of social engagement through team-building activities. Recognition for your results comes in the form of bonuses and rewards.

Your ultimate objective is to connect people with essential technology while enjoying a rewarding, growth-focused environment that values your energy and ambition.

Potential Downsides

This role requires a manual driving licence and regular travel. It won’t be suitable for those seeking remote or stationary work, as field sales are fully in-person.

Because commission is heavily performance-driven, those not confident in self-motivation or communication might find the environment more demanding and less rewarding over the long term.
